搜索到与相关的文章
Hadoop

使用Hadoop MapReduce 进行排序

本文转自:http://www.alidw.com/?p=1420在hadoop中的例子TeraSort,就是一个利用mapredue进行排序的例子。本文参考并简化了这个例子:排序的基本思想是利用了mapreduce的自动排序功能,在hadoop中,从map到reduce阶段,map出来的结构会按照各个key按照hash值分配到各个reduce中,其中,在reduce中所有的key都是有序的了。如果使用一个reduce,那么我们直接将他output出来就行

系统 2019-08-12 09:30:30 3209

编程技术

数据延迟加载

看来lazyload.js不能真正的实现数据动态加载了,只是一个样子,其实我们实现动态加载不过是为了减轻服务器的压力而已,lazyload.js显示是个花架子,如何实现真正的动态加载,需要对lazyload.js做改装。我认为,动态加载本质上都是一样的,即:图片或者数据一开始不会被加载,当你触发了滚动条(说明你想继续看这个网站)那么图片或者数据开始加载。那么实现的方法其实有很多,但是基本上都是通过替换的方式来实现的。1.土豆:

系统 2019-08-29 23:45:30 3208

Python

pyspider all [python3.7]报错 已解决

报错内容Traceback(mostrecentcalllast):File"/Library/anaconda3/bin/pyspider",line6,infrompyspider.runimportmainFile"/Library/anaconda3/lib/python3.7/site-packages/pyspider/run.py",line231async=True,get_object=False,no_input=False):^Syn

系统 2019-09-27 17:46:30 3207

IOS

【一步一步学IOS5 】 应用Property List 强化你

前面我们已经创建了一个简单的表视图应用程序,显示菜谱列表。分析一下代码,你会发现所有的菜谱都应编码在源代码中。之前,我们只考虑让事情变得简单,并着重演示如何创建一个UITableView应用程序。然而,将所有元素比硬编码在代码中并不是推荐的方法。在真实的App开发中,我们常常将这些静态元素存放在外部(如菜谱列表)文件或数据库或其它地方。在IOS编程中,有一种类型的文件,成为PropertyList.这一类型的文件通常在MacOS和iOS中发现,用来存放简单

系统 2019-08-12 09:30:35 3207

编程技术

JVM Perm方法存储区,后面有一点跑题

在一个jvm实例的内部,类型信息被存储在一个称为方法区的内存逻辑区中。类型信息是由类加载器在类加载时从类文件中提取出来的。类(静态)变量也存储在方法区中如果上面写的是对的,那么在我们静态变量用多了的情况下,就会出现java.lang.OutOfMemoryError:PermGenspace所以那个permSize一直不释放是合理的,因为static变量JVM一般情况下是不会去回收。我刚才看了一下我们状态的所有JAR包也只有一百二十几M,但是为什么我们设年

系统 2019-08-12 09:29:29 3207

redis

ZINTERSTORE — Redis 命令参考

ZINTERSTORE—Redis命令参考ZINTERSTOREdestinationnumkeyskey[key...][WEIGHTSweight[weight...]][AGGREGATESUM|MIN|MAX]计算给定的一个或多个有序集的交集,其中给定key的数量必须以numkeys参数指定,并将该交集(结果集)储存到destination。默认情况下,结果集中某个成员的score值是所有给定集下该成员score值之和.关于WEIGHTS和AGGR

系统 2019-08-12 01:54:47 3207

Python

使用python代码调用三汇语音卡硬件拨打电话

defpush_notification_by_call(voice,worker_phone_num):"""语音提醒:paramvoice:音频文件:paramworker_phone_num:用户电话:return:"""phone_num=str(worker_phone_num)shap3=ctypes.cdll.LoadLibrary("C:\Windows\SHP_A3.dll")#加载动态链接库shap3.SsmStartCti(path.

系统 2019-09-27 17:52:48 3206

ASP.NET

跨入asp.net大门

跨入asp.net大门刚刚会C#,就按奈不住,试试asp.net。直冲asp.net大门,结果没走好,踢门槛上了……使用asp.net网站管理工具安全设置向导,定义了角色,创建新用户的时候,总提示“密码最短长度为7,其中必须包含以下非字母数字字符:1。”上网一查才发现,原来密码中需要有至少一位的非数字也非字母的字符(开始理解错了,以为微软说非字母的数字字符呢!而且还必须包括1。。。)改了密码,OK!创建成功。虽然走急了点,还好没摔倒,跨入asp.net大门

系统 2019-08-29 23:50:03 3206

ASP.NET

Scott Mitchell 的ASP.NET 2.0数据教程之三十四

ScottMitchell的ASP.NET2.0数据教程之三十四::跨页面的主/从报表导言在前面一章里我们学习了如何在一个页里显示主/从信息.另外一种经常使用的模式就是将主从信息用两个页分别显示.在前面的跨页面的主/从报表我们通过GridView显示所有的supplier来使用这个模式.GridView里包含一个HyperLinkField,链接到另外一个页,并将SupplierID通过querystring传过去.第二个页使用GridView列出了选中的

系统 2019-08-29 22:59:34 3206

编程技术

通过Toad工具查看dmp里面的表

今天有同事要查看dmp里面的表是否有数据,虽然可以把单表数据通过exp导出查看,但还是稍显有点麻烦,要花时间。无意中发现toad工具可以直接查看dmp里面的表数据。第一步:Database-->Export-->ExportfileBrowse第二步:找到dmp文件第三步:查看表内容通过Toad工具查看dmp里面的表

系统 2019-08-12 01:33:45 3206